Excerpt from Religions of Primitive Peoples: 1896-1897 At this conference Prof. Jastrow submitted a plan for establishing popular lecture courses on the his torical study of religions by securing the co-opera tion of existing institutions and lecture associations, such as the Lowell, Brooklyn, and Peabody Insti tutes, the University Lecture Association of Phila delphia, and some of our colleges and universities. Each course, according to this plan, was to consist of from six to eight lectures, and the engagement of lecturers, choice of subjects, and so forth were to be in the hands of a committee chosen from the differ ent cities, and representing the various institutions and associations participating. This general scheme met with the cordial approval of the conference. About the Publisher Forgotten Books publishes hundreds of thousands of rare and classic books.
